网络流量峰值问题一直是IT行业中的主要挑战之一。无论是大型企业的在线服务,还是小型电商平台,在用户访问量突然增加时,系统的负担可能迅速加重,导致性能下降甚至服务中断。有效应对网络流量高峰成为了网络技术专家和运营者必须面对的重要课题。本文深度探讨如何通过多种策略来管理和优化网络流量,以确保在高峰时段依然能够提供稳定的服务。

云计算技术的普及为流量管理提供了极大的便利。灵活的云服务能帮助企业根据实时的流量需求调整资源。这种弹性不仅让企业能够在业务高峰期快速扩展,降低流量峰值对本地服务器的压力,还能在低谷期节约资源成本。通过利用云负载均衡,企业能够智能分配流量,将请求分散至不同服务器,确保不会因服务器过载而造成性能下降。
在网络架构方面,内容分发网络(CDN)是应对流量高峰的有效解决方案。CDN能够将内容缓存到离用户更近的节点,实现快速加载和降低延迟。这对于需要处理大量视频内容或电商秒杀活动的网站尤为重要。通过将流量分散至多个边缘节点,不仅提升了用户体验,也显著减少了源服务器的负担。
性能监测工具的运用同样不可忽视。实时监控系统与应用性能管理(APM)工具能够提供流量使用情况的详细数据,帮助企业判断何时需要扩展资源。预警机制可以在流量异常增加的情况下及时警报,让系统管理员可以迅速做出反应,执行相应的应对措施。
在DIY组装与性能优化方面,企业内部也可以建设分布式架构以降低单点故障的影响。通过将服务分布至多个物理机或虚拟机,企业可以增强资源利用率,确保高峰流量不会让某一台机器耗尽资源。采用微服务架构的企业能够更灵活地扩展特定的服务模块,以应对不同类型的流量高峰。
最重要的是,进行负载测试至关重要。模拟高峰期的流量场景可以帮助企业提早识别系统瓶颈和脆弱环节,从而制定出更有效的优化策略。负载测试的结果还可直接指导开发团队在系统设计时进行优化,提升整体性能。
随着技术的不断进步,网络流量的管理策略也在不断迭代更新。企业需要密切关注这些动态,结合实际情况,持续优化网络架构与技术,以应对未来可能出现的流量挑战。
常见问题解答 (FAQ)
1. 什么是流量峰值?
流量峰值是指在特定时间段内,用户访问量或数据传输量达到的最高水平。
2. 云负载均衡的优势是什么?
云负载均衡可以动态分配流量至不同的服务器,提升系统的可用性和响应速度,减少因过载导致的故障风险。
3. 如何选择合适的CDN服务?
选择CDN服务时应考虑覆盖范围、延迟、价格和支持的内容类型,确保能够满足企业的特定需求。
4. 负载测试应该如何实施?
负载测试可以通过专业测试工具模拟真实用户行为,评估系统在高流量下的性能表现,以识别潜在问题。
5. 如何优化网络架构?
优化网络架构可以通过分布式系统设计、微服务架构和定期的系统评估来实现,确保在高峰时段依然稳定运行。
